Ark. Code Ann. § 25-38-210

Agricultural exchanges

Acts 2013, No. 1501, § 1; 2019, No. 910, § 124.

The Department of Agriculture shall:

(1) Evaluate the potential economic benefits to Arkansas and Arkansas farmers of entering into agricultural exchanges with Israel and other countries that will foster the development of trade, mutual assistance, and business relations between Arkansas and the other country; and

(2) Annually report the department's findings under subdivision (1) of this section to the House Committee on Agriculture, Forestry, and Economic Development and the Senate Committee on Agriculture, Forestry, and Economic Development.
